    In 2007, DC Released Superman Doomsday. This covered the Death of Superman story where Superman fought Doomsday. 11 years later, DC retells the story. The story seems to pick up after Justice League War. The Justice League has been assembled and is now funded by the UN. Superman is having issues navigating his personal and league life. Afraid to bring Lois into the world of gods and monsters, Superman struggles with taking the relationship to the next level. Meanwhile, a dark cloud looms on the horizon. Crash landing in the sea, the asteroid brings the harbringer of death... Doomsday. This is the key points of the Death of Superman. The majority of the movie is either Clark Kent (Superman) navigating his relationship with Lois Lane or the Justice League fighting Doomsday. This is both a strong point and a detriment to the movie. The part about Superman and Lois was well written. How does a hero balance his personal and public lives? Can you bring someone else into your world without endangering them? These key questions are wrestled with during the story. This story arch comes to an abrupt end as the Doomsday arch swells. The Doomsday story is the monster that leaves destruction in its wake. Doomsday kills without remorse. Doomsday feeds off of violence. Doomsday is the ultimate killing machine. If you know the story, or read the title, you know how this movie ends. It is about Superman's death. Unlike the 2007 Superman Doomsday (which tells both the death and ressurection of Superman), this film only focuses on the Death of Superman, making it feel like half a movie. Batman vs Superman (2016) dealth with the Death of Superman, only to have him revived in Justice League (2017). It seems to me like DC is planning an animated cinematic universe to make up for the live action movies performing poorly at the box office. Given that there are two major plot lines in this film, I'm a little disappointed. The fights are fun to watch. There were a few times where I was like "ooh.. that had to hurt". The brutality of Doomsday gave DC quite a bit to work with. The Superman/Lois arch was well written. The Credits even drop hints at upcoming DC animated films. I would recommend buying this movie. I enjoyed it quite a bit despite it feeling like half a story. I look forward to the animated ressurection of Superman.

    DC's retelling of the Death of Superman saga is a more fleshed out version of its epic version 11 years ago. This telling has a different voice cast that out shines the original work. Jerry O'Connell and wife Rebecca Romign are perfect as Clark and Lois. The natural chemistry makes their readings more believable. The rest of the cast are as good. The best aspect of this version is DC's vision to break the story into at a least two parts. There's more room to explore what's going on with Supes. He's conflicted with what to do about his relationship with Lois but now has to go face his greats physical challenge. It doesn't feel as condensed as the first version. The animation is spectacular as usual. Maybe DC should let these guys do the live action stuff as well.
